The Lynx necklace is inspired by the Goddess Freja and the two mythical felines that pull her chariot. To honor & celebrate Freya's power, passion & love, we have designed this pendant. The expression is a mix of wildness and feminine grace. The jewelry is handmade in Sweden from recycled Sterling Silver 935.

SLOW FASHION

All our pieces are made to perfection by hand in our local foundry in Sweden, with 100% recycled 935 Sterling Silver being our main metal of use. We ethically & sustainably craft our jewellery in Sweden, with an aim to continuous develop in a slow fashion manner.

MORE THAN UNIQUE DESIGNS

Freya & Thor of Sweden offers handmade jewellery with a unique, modern & minimalistic design. The brand was founded in 2017, with the mission to create jewellery taking inspiration from Norse Mythology. The God of Thunder Thor’s hammer “Mjolner” became the first symbol used in our pieces. In 2020 we launched an equal focus on Goddess Freya & her “Golden Tears”.
